Nai Raneri Village Overview

Nai Raneri is a village in Gudha Malani tehsil of Barmer district, Rajasthan. It lies about 72 km from Gudha Malani tehsil headquarters and around 62 km from Barmer district headquarters. As per available records (2009), Kamthai is the Gram Panchayat for Nai Raneri village.

Village Location & Administration

As per Census 2011, the village code of Nai Raneri is 087869. The village covers a geographical area of 481 hectares and has a pincode of 344033. Barmer is the nearest town, located about 62 km away.

Nai Raneri village is governed under the Panchayati Raj system, with a Sarpanch serving as the elected head of the village. For political representation, the village falls under the Siwana Vidhan Sabha constituency and the Barmer Lok Sabha constituency. Population & Demographics of Nai Raneri

This section provides population and demographic details of Nai Raneri village as per Census 2011, including gender-wise and social category-wise data.

ParticularsTotalMaleFemale
Total Population 490 257 233
Child Population (0–6 yrs) 87 46 41
Scheduled Castes (SC) 172 96 76
Scheduled Tribes (ST) N/A N/A N/A
Literate Population 215 137 78
Illiterate Population 275 120 155

Key population details of Nai Raneri village are given below:

  • Nai Raneri village is a small village with a total population of around 490, including approximately 257 males and 233 females, with a sex ratio of 906 females per 1,000 males.
  • The number of children aged 0–6 years in the village is relatively low.
  • 172 residents belong to the Scheduled Castes (SC).
  • The literacy level of Nai Raneri village is moderate, with a literacy rate of about 43.88%.
  • There are around 72 households in Nai Raneri village.

Transport & Connectivity of Nai Raneri

Transport facilities help residents of Nai Raneri village travel to nearby towns for work, education, healthcare, and daily needs. The village has access to public bus service, private bus service and a railway station.

Connectivity Type Status (in year 2011)
Public Bus Service Available within 5 - 10 km distance
Private Bus Service Available within 5 - 10 km distance
Railway Station Available within 10+ km distance
